Why Fall Solar Maintenance Matters
Solar systems require less upkeep than many home systems, but a little attention in the fall goes a long way. Seasonal maintenance can:
- Maximize energy production during shorter winter days
- Prevent damage from falling leaves, debris, and ice
- Extend the life of your solar panels and equipment
- Protect wiring and connections from seasonal weather changes
- Give you peace of mind heading into colder months
- Inspect and Clean Solar Panels
Falling leaves, pollen, and summer dust can reduce panel efficiency.
- Gently rinse panels with a garden hose if they look dirty
- Use a soft brush or squeegee for stubborn spots
- Avoid harsh cleaning agents or abrasive materials
If your panels are difficult to reach, consider seeking out a professional cleaning service to avoid safety risks.
- Check for Shade from Trees
As the angle of the sun shifts in fall, new shadows can reduce solar production.
- Look for overhanging branches or nearby trees casting shade
- Trim back vegetation that may block sunlight
- Remove leaves or debris that collect on or near panels
Maintaining clear sunlight paths helps your panels perform at their best.
- Inspect Wiring and Connections
Seasonal weather changes—temperature swings, rain, and wind—can put stress on electrical components.
- Look for exposed or damaged wiring
- Check junction boxes for loose connections
- Make sure conduit and mounting hardware are secure
If you notice anything unusual, schedule a professional inspection.
- Review Your Inverter Display or Monitoring App
Your inverter or monitoring system provides real-time data on your system’s performance. Fall is a good time to:
- Confirm your system is producing energy as expected
- Check for error messages or warning lights
- Compare seasonal production to last year’s output
Monitoring your system helps you catch small issues before they become big problems.
- Prepare for Storms and Winter Weather
Fall storms and colder months can bring heavy winds, snow, and ice. Take steps now to protect your solar system:
- Ensure panels and racking are firmly secured
- Keep gutters and downspouts clear to prevent overflow near equipment
- Have a plan for safe snow removal if panels are heavily covered
Solar systems are built to withstand the elements, but proactive care provides added protection.
- Inspect Battery Storage (If Applicable)
If your solar system includes a battery backup, fall is the perfect time to:
- Check the battery enclosure for debris, pests, or water damage
- Review system charge and discharge performance
- Schedule maintenance to ensure readiness for winter outages
A healthy battery system provides peace of mind when storms cause power interruptions.
